向治洪

《React Native移动开发实战》1,2《Kotlin实战》《Weex开发实战》和《Flutter实战》开发交流群:515980159
1.1K 篇文章
642.6K 次阅读
118 人订阅

全部文章

xiangzhihong

Android 面试之必问性能优化

对于Android开发者来说,懂得基本的应用开发技能往往是不够,因为不管是工作还是面试,都需要开发者懂得大量的性能优化,这对提升应用的体验是非常重要的。对于An...

7530
xiangzhihong

Android 面试之必问Android基础

在上一篇文章Android 面试之必问Java基础一文中,我们介绍了Java面试的一些常见的基础面试题,下面我们来介绍Android开发的一些必问知识点。

8020
xiangzhihong

Android Gradle必备基础知识

随着Google对Eclipse的无情抛弃以及Studio的不断壮大,Android开发者逐渐拜倒在Studio的石榴裙下。 而作为Studio的默...

5110
xiangzhihong

Android 面试之必问高级知识点

在Android早期的版本中,应用程序的运行环境是需要依赖Dalvik虚拟机的。不过,在后来的版本(大概是4.x版本),Android的运行环境却换到了 And...

5520
xiangzhihong

今年春晚不一样,XR技术如何打造移步换景

不知道大家发现没有,相比前几届春晚,《2021年春节联欢晚会》的视觉效果可谓焕然一新,很多节目都可以看到新科技的东西,比如AR、XR、电影特效技术等将现实舞台上...

15200
xiangzhihong

移动开发抓包方案

在移动应用开发过程中,我们会使用Charles和Fiddler进行抓包。通常要抓取HTTPS加密的数据包,一般使用Charles或者Fiddler4代理HTTP...

28110
xiangzhihong

Android 性能优化(二)

在大部分Android平台的设备上,Android系统是16ms刷新一次,也就是一秒钟60帧。要达到这种刷新速度就要求在ui线程中处理的任务时间必须要小于16m...

28140
xiangzhihong

Android性能优化(一)

一个应用App的启动速度能够影响用户的首次体验,启动速度较慢(感官上)的应用可能导致用户再次开启App的意图下降,或者卸载放弃该应用程序。

23020
xiangzhihong

JVM及其工作流程

程序计数器(Program Counter Register) 是一块较小的内存空间,它可以看作是当前线程所执行的字节码的行号指示器。

15440
xiangzhihong

Vue开发的仿美团外卖Html5前端页面

今天给大家开源一个仿美团外卖的Vue项目,介绍Vue和vue-router的基本用法。

26610
xiangzhihong

微信小程序云开发

微信小程序有一个云开发的功能,可以省去很多的后台开发的任务。不过,使用小程序云开发需要注册的小程序appid,测试和游客没有云开发功能的。如果你还没有注册小程序...

80410
xiangzhihong

微信小程序云开发

微信小程序有一个云开发的功能,可以省去很多的后台开发的任务。不过,使用小程序云开发需要注册的小程序appid,测试和游客没有云开发功能的。如果你还没有注册小程序...

47430
xiangzhihong

Flutter 底部向上动画弹出菜单

在移动应用开发中,我们经常会遇到弹出菜单的开发需求,对于下拉菜单可以参考Flutter 自定义下拉菜单,而如果是向上的弹出菜单或者更加负责的扇形菜单,则需要开发...

12800
xiangzhihong

Vue开发仿京东商场app

vue3-jd-h5是一个电商H5页面前端项目,基于Vue 3.0.0 + Vant 3.0.0 实现,主要包括首页、分类页面、我的页面、购物车等,部分效果如...

6500
xiangzhihong

Android Jetpack架构组件(十)之Slices

Slice 是一种界面模板,可以在 Google 搜索应用中以及 Google 助理中等其他位置显示您应用中的丰富而动态的互动内容。同时,Slice 支持全屏应...

29000
xiangzhihong

Android Jetpack架构组件(九)之Paging

在Android应用开发中,我们经常需要以列表的方式来展示大量的数据,这些数据可能来自网路,也可以来自本地的数据库。为了避免一次性加载大量的数据,对数据进行分页...

21620
xiangzhihong

Android Jetpack架构组件(八)之DataBinding

在传统的Android应用开发中,布局文件通常只负责应用界面的布局工作,如果需要实现页面交互就需要调用setContentView()将Activity、fra...

23220
xiangzhihong

Android Jetpack架构组件(七)之WorkManager

在Android应用开发中,或多或少的会有后台任务的需求,根据需求场景的不同,Android为后台任务提供了多种不同的解决方案,如Service、Loader、...

20010
xiangzhihong

Android Jetpack架构组件(一)与AndroidX

自2008年9月22日谷歌发布Android 1.0版本到前不久Android 12版本到发布,Android已经陪伴我们走过了12个年头。可以说,经过12年的...

29100
xiangzhihong

Android Jetpack架构组件(二)之Lifecycle

一直以来,解藕都是软件开发永恒的话题。在Android开发中,解藕很大程度上表现为系统组件的生命周期与普通组件之间的解藕,因为普通组件在使用过程中需要依赖系统组...

22500

扫码关注云+社区

领取腾讯云代金券